Selective dimerization of a C2H2 zinc finger subfamily.
Molecular cell - 1 Feb 2003
McCarty Aaron S, Kleiger Gary, Eisenberg David, Smale Stephen T
Abstract excerpt
The C2H2 zinc finger is the most prevalent protein motif in the mammalian proteome. Two C2H2 fingers in Ikaros are dedicated to homotypic interactions between family members. We show here that these fingers comprise a bona fide dimerization domain. Dimerization is highly selective, however, as homologous domains from the TRPS-1 and Drosophila Hunchback proteins support homodimerization, but not heterodimerization...
